WebThe principal event, sometimes referred to as the Darfield earthquake, struck at 4:35 am on September 4, 2010. The earthquake’s epicentre was located some 25 miles (40 km) west of Christchurch near the town of Darfield, and the focus was located about 6 miles (10 km) beneath the surface. Web3.5 New Zealand’s human rights systems. 31. New Zealand’s human rights systems include laws that give effect to international human rights instruments.
